Output 61bad9fdc9a246050c45faa4dd981e0115aaf1fc896a76c77eb11b4032176868:1

value
11439900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1dfb8b43359db2ff9dda115cff4c0e0567193aa OP_EQUALVERIFY OP_CHECKSIG
address
1L8iEY2Hdd9RwrExKu2kp3Y2i4499eg471
transaction
61bad9fdc9a246050c45faa4dd981e0115aaf1fc896a76c77eb11b4032176868
spent
true